Wulfenite
Part of speech: noun
Definitions
- A mineral composed of lead and molybdenum that commonly forms bright yellow to orange crystals in specific oxidized environments

Etymology: The term "wulfenite" refers to a lead molybdate mineral that is prized for its vibrant yellow to orange coloration and distinct tetragonal crystal structure. Its name traces back to the 18th century, specifically to the mineralogist Franz Xavier von Wulfen, who conducted significant studies on minerals in the region of Styria, Austria. Wulfen's contributions to mineralogy were substantial, and in recognition of his work, the mineral was named in his honor after his death in 1805. This connection highlights how the legacy of an individual can shape the scientific lexicon, immortalizing their contributions in the very names of the elements they studied. The first recorded use of the term "wulfenite" in English can be traced to around 1845. During this period, mineralogy was becoming increasingly formalized as a science, and new discoveries were being classified and named with greater precision. The mineral itself, known for its striking appearance and rarity, drew the attention of collectors and scientists alike, further embedding the term in the lexicon of geology. The etymology of "wulfenite" is straightforward, constructed from the name "Wulfen" and the suffix "-ite," which is commonly used in mineralogy to denote minerals or rocks. The suffix comes from the Greek "lithos," meaning "stone," but in this context, it suggests a mineral or rock substance, following the convention established in the naming of various minerals.
